Abstract

An adjustable linear gauge including a linear track having uniformly spaced indentations along a surface thereof, and an adjustable member moveable along the track which includes a body portion carrying a stop member adapted to engage an end of a work piece to accurately position the work piece relative to a machine for performing an operation on the work piece. The adjustable member further includes a pivotable component that has a surface with one or more projections for engaging the spaced indentations on the track. The latter component is pivotally attached to the body portion and biased toward engagement with the indentations. The pivotable component further being is integral with a handle for manual application of a force to pivot the projections out of engagement with the indentations, the stop member and the surface with projections being located on rotationally opposite sides of the pivot point connecting the pivotable component to the body portion so that application of force against the end of the stop member causes an increase in pressure by the projections against the indentations. Preferably, the gauge further includes a graduated linear scale for visually indicating the position of the stop member. Also, the body portion includes an opening for viewing a point on said scale spaced on the body portion away from the stop member, and an adjustable moveable visual indicator for setting a point on the scale at a selected distance away from the stop member so that a linear distance subtraction can be factored into the positioning of the stop.
